Summary

On 20 September 1983 at about 12:00 local time, a Gates Learjet 35A registered N780A was involved in an accident near Massena, New York, United States. 9 people were on board and one had minor injuries.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

PASSENGERS DESCRIBED TOUCHDOWN AS FAST & LONG WITH NO ENG NOISE ASSOCIATED WITH REVERSE THRUST IMMEDIATELY AFTER TOUCHDOWN. THE ACFT RAN OFF THE END OF THE RWY & THE NOSE GEAR SEPARATED. ACCORDING TO THE CREW THE PLT INITIATED THE THRUST REVERSERS AFTER TOUCHDOWN, HOWEVER, THE PINS DID NOT REMOVE & THE THRUST LEVERS WERE RESTORED. AS BRAKING WAS EMPLOYED, THE THRUST REVERSERS WERE RE-INITIATED. THE PINS REMOVED & FULL REVERSE WAS APPLIED. BY THIS TIME THERE WAS INSUFFICIENT RWY REMAINING TO INITIATE A GO-AROUND. THE SQUAT SWITCH RELAY PANEL PREVENTS OPERATION OF THE THRUST REVERSER SYSTEM UNTIL THE SQUAT SWITCHES ARE IN THE GROUND MODE. THE GROUND SPOILERS WERE NOT DEPLOYED.
